Västerås slott is a medieval keep folded into a Vasa castle, burned in 1736 and rebuilt by Carl Hårleman into its present residency form. The earliest keep was raised in the 1200s at the mouth of Svartån into Lake Mälaren as shelter and…

Timeline
- 1736-1758
After the fire of 1736, Carl Hårleman oversaw the reconstruction of the palace. The floor arrangement was reorganized, the rooms on the ground floor were given vaulted ceilings, and an additional top story was added to serve as the county…
